Searched refs:NodeRareData (Results 1 - 19 of 19) sorted by relevance

/external/chromium_org/third_party/WebKit/Source/core/dom/
H A DNodeRareData.cpp32 #include "core/dom/NodeRareData.h"
47 COMPILE_ASSERT(sizeof(NodeRareData) == sizeof(SameSizeAsNodeRareData), NodeRareDataShouldStaySmall);
49 void NodeRareData::traceAfterDispatch(Visitor* visitor)
62 void NodeRareData::trace(Visitor* visitor)
70 void NodeRareData::finalizeGarbageCollectedObject()
76 this->~NodeRareData();
80 COMPILE_ASSERT(Page::maxNumberOfFrames < (1 << NodeRareData::ConnectedFrameCountBits), Frame_limit_should_fit_in_rare_data_count);
H A DNodeRareData.h58 class NodeRareData : public NoBaseWillBeGarbageCollectedFinalized<NodeRareData>, public NodeRareDataBase { class in namespace:blink
59 WTF_MAKE_NONCOPYABLE(NodeRareData);
62 static NodeRareData* create(RenderObject* renderer)
64 return new NodeRareData(renderer);
115 explicit NodeRareData(RenderObject* renderer) function in class:blink::NodeRareData
H A DElementRareData.cpp38 struct SameSizeAsElementRareData : NodeRareData {
74 NodeRareData::traceAfterDispatch(visitor);
H A DElementRareData.h29 #include "core/dom/NodeRareData.h"
43 class ElementRareData : public NodeRareData {
162 : NodeRareData(renderer)
H A DTreeScopeAdopter.cpp30 #include "core/dom/NodeRareData.h"
64 NodeRareData* rareData = node->rareData();
135 NodeRareData* rareData = node.rareData();
H A DNode.h69 class NodeRareData;
110 // Oilpan: This member is traced in NodeRareData.
753 NodeRareData* rareData() const;
754 NodeRareData& ensureRareData();
H A DNode.cpp50 #include "core/dom/NodeRareData.h"
344 NodeRareData* Node::rareData() const
347 return static_cast<NodeRareData*>(m_data.m_rareData);
350 NodeRareData& Node::ensureRareData()
358 m_data.m_rareData = NodeRareData::create(m_data.m_renderer);
376 delete static_cast<NodeRareData*>(m_data.m_rareData);
/external/chromium_org/third_party/WebKit/Source/core/
H A Dwebcore_dom.target.darwin-arm.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.darwin-arm64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.darwin-mips.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.darwin-mips64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.darwin-x86.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.darwin-x86_64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-arm.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-arm64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-mips.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-mips64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-x86.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\
H A Dwebcore_dom.target.linux-x86_64.mk108 third_party/WebKit/Source/core/dom/NodeRareData.cpp \

Completed in 512 milliseconds